Recent discussions within the tech hacking community reveal that users have successfully implemented additional Tailscale tricks on jailbroken Kindle devices. Tailscale, a popular VPN and mesh networking tool, has traditionally been used on more open platforms, but now enthusiasts are adapting it for Kindle’s modified environment. These configurations include custom scripts and network routing setups that allow Kindle users to access home networks, securely connect to remote servers, and bypass some regional restrictions.
Sources such as developer forums and community blogs confirm that these modifications require a jailbroken Kindle running a customized firmware, typically based on Linux. Users have reported that installing Tailscale on these devices involves manually compiling binaries, editing configuration files, and sometimes patching the Kindle’s operating system to support additional network features. While these tricks are not officially supported, they demonstrate a growing trend of expanding Kindle capabilities beyond standard e-reading functions.
It is important to note that implementing these configurations involves technical risk, including voiding warranties and potentially bricking devices if done incorrectly. Nonetheless, the community’s success stories suggest that, with proper caution, users can significantly enhance their Kindle’s network functions.

Background on Tailscale and Kindle Jailbreaking Efforts
Tailscale is a VPN solution built on WireGuard, designed to simplify secure network connectivity across devices. It has gained popularity among tech enthusiasts for its ease of use and flexibility. Meanwhile, jailbreaking Kindle devices—modifying the firmware to unlock additional features—has been an ongoing activity within the hacking community for several years. Early efforts focused on enabling sideloading of apps and custom firmware, but recent developments have shifted toward network customization.
In 2023, community forums documented initial attempts to run Tailscale on jailbroken Kindles, primarily for accessing home networks remotely. These efforts involved compiling custom binaries compatible with Kindle’s Linux-based OS and configuring network settings manually. The latest updates suggest that users are now sharing more refined configurations and scripts, indicating a maturing of this hacking niche.
While Amazon has not officially supported these modifications, the community’s ongoing work reflects a broader interest in making Kindles more versatile devices beyond their primary function as e-readers.

Key Questions
Can I install Tailscale on my Kindle without jailbreaking?
Currently, installing Tailscale requires a jailbroken Kindle with custom firmware. Official Kindle firmware does not support Tailscale or similar VPN tools.
What are the risks of modifying my Kindle with these tricks?
Risks include voiding your warranty, bricking the device, or creating security vulnerabilities. Proceed only if you have technical experience and understand the potential consequences.
Will Amazon support these modifications in the future?
There is no official indication that Amazon plans to support Tailscale or similar customizations. These efforts remain community-driven and unofficial.
How stable are these Tailscale configurations on Kindle?
Initial reports suggest they are functional, but long-term stability and security are still unconfirmed. Users should test cautiously and stay aware of potential issues.
